[PATCH] wr841: find v10 and set BOARD config

Steffen Pankratz kratz00 at gmx.de
Sa Nov 21 11:50:06 CET 2015


On Sat, 21 Nov 2015 08:20:16 +0100
Tim Niemeyer <tim.niemeyer at mastersword.de> wrote:

Hi Tim

> Außerdem muss man vllt noch kurz dazu sagen, dass ich das noch nicht
> getestet hab. ;)

Ich habe es getestet, schaut gut aus!
Deinen Patch habe ich gemerged.

"Mein" WR841 v10 (siehe (1) und (2)) laeuft jetzt auch mit dem Patch.


Gruss
-Steffen

(1) https://monitoring.freifunk-franken.de/routers/564f22fc44ce6e41d5668c65
(2) https://netmon.freifunk-franken.de/router.php?router_id=1787
 
> Am Samstag, den 21.11.2015, 08:19 +0100 schrieb Tim Niemeyer:
> > Signed-off-by: Tim Niemeyer <tim.niemeyer at mastersword.de>
> > ---
> > Ich hab gedacht wir könnten halt auch den v10 einfach suchen und
> > dann die board.model.name Variable entsprechend setzen. Das ist
> > zwar alles noch nicht so richtig cool, aber wir würden erst einmal
> > kompatibel bleiben und das Update Script würde auch noch gehen.
> > 
> > Langfristig sollte sich allerdings dann mal jemand damit
> > beschäftigen, wie man die Boards nun richtig bennen. Ich bin da
> > zumindest für meinen Teil immer noch etwas verwirrt.
> > 
> >  bsp/default/root_file_system/etc/rc.local.tpl        |  3 +++
> >  bsp/wr841/root_file_system/etc/network.tl-wr841n-v10 | 11
> > +++++++++++ 2 files changed, 14 insertions(+)
> >  create mode 100644
> > bsp/wr841/root_file_system/etc/network.tl-wr841n-v10
> > 
> > diff --git a/bsp/default/root_file_system/etc/rc.local.tpl
> > b/bsp/default/root_file_system/etc/rc.local.tpl index
> > b40c75f..d4ca6e4 100755 ---
> > a/bsp/default/root_file_system/etc/rc.local.tpl +++
> > b/bsp/default/root_file_system/etc/rc.local.tpl @@ -16,6 +16,9 @@
> > case "$BOARD" in tl-wr841n-v7)
> >          BOARD=tl-wr841nd-v7
> >          ;;
> > +    tl-wr841n-v9)
> > +        grep "v10" /var/sysinfo/model && BOARD=tl-wr841n-v10
> > +        ;;
> >  esac
> >  if ! uci get board.model.name; then
> >      uci set board.model.name=$BOARD
> > diff --git a/bsp/wr841/root_file_system/etc/network.tl-wr841n-v10
> > b/bsp/wr841/root_file_system/etc/network.tl-wr841n-v10 new file
> > mode 100644 index 0000000..02cefd8
> > --- /dev/null
> > +++ b/bsp/wr841/root_file_system/etc/network.tl-wr841n-v10
> > @@ -0,0 +1,11 @@
> > +
> > +WANDEV=eth1
> > +# WANDEV=eth0
> > +SWITCHDEV=eth0
> > +CLIENT_PORTS="1 2 0t"
> > +WAN_PORTS=
> > +BATMAN_PORTS="3 4 0t"
> > +
> > +CLIENTIF="eth0.1 w2ap"
> > +ETHMESHMAC=eth1
> > +ROUTERMAC=eth0
> 


-- 
Hermes powered by Manjaro Linux (Linux 4.2.5)

Best regards, Steffen Pankratz.
-------------- nächster Teil --------------
Ein Dateianhang mit Binärdaten wurde abgetrennt...
Dateiname   : nicht verfügbar
Dateityp    : application/pgp-signature
Dateigröße  : 181 bytes
Beschreibung: OpenPGP digital signature
URL         : <http://lists.freifunk.net/pipermail/franken-dev-freifunk.net/attachments/20151121/b4feaec9/attachment-0002.sig>


Mehr Informationen über die Mailingliste franken-dev